family Lamiaceae (noun) genus Acinos (noun)
a large family of aromatic herbs and shrubs having flowers resembling the lips of a mouth and four-lobed ovaries yielding four one-seeded nutlets and including mint, thyme, sage, rosemary plants closely allied to the genera Satureja and Calamintha
